The Redding 222 Remington Bushing Full Length Type S Die gives you full-length resizing and precise neck control in a single operation—a combination serious reloaders value for consistent case dimensions and reliable feeding. Type S dies are built around Redding's bushing system, which lets you dial in exactly how much of the case neck gets sized, rather than forcing a one-size-fits-all approach. If you're loading for a 222 Remington and want to maintain tight neck concentricity while resizing the body, this die delivers that level of control.
What sets the Type S design apart is the self-centering bushing, which rides on the case neck itself and automatically corrects minor misalignment. That means better runout and more uniform loaded rounds, especially important if you're chasing accuracy at distance or competition. The adjustable decapping rod lets you fine-tune how deep the bushing seats, so you can resize only the portion of the neck you need—handy for preserving work-hardened brass or avoiding unnecessary sizing on lightly fired cases. The die comes with both a standard-size button and a decapping pin retainer, and the bushing system uses the same interchangeable components as Redding's dedicated neck sizing dies, so if you ever expand your reloading setup, you're not locked into one approach.
One often-overlooked benefit: remove the bushing and internal components, and the Type S die functions as a body die. That flexibility means one die can pull double duty in your progressive or single-stage press, saving bench space and cost.
